BITSAT Expected Cutoff 2026: Branch-Wise Predictions

Based on the three-year trajectory, cutoffs in 2026 are expected to remain near 2025 levels, with a marginal further dip of 5–10 points possible if exam difficulty stays similar.

Programme

Pilani

Goa

Hyderabad

B.E. Computer Science

290–305

260–275

255–270

B.E. Electronics & Communication

272–288

245–260

245–258

B.E. Electrical & Electronics

248–262

232–245

228–242

B.E. Mathematics & Computing

282–296

255–270

252–266

B.E. Electronics & Instrumentation

238–252

222–236

220–234

B.E. Mechanical

222–238

212–226

205–218

B.E. Chemical

198–213

194–208

193–207

B.E. Civil

193–208

192–205

M.Sc. Economics

238–253

226–240

220–234

M.Sc. Mathematics

217–230

205–218

202–215

*Note: The 2026 figures are projections based on historical trends. Actual cutoffs will vary based on exam difficulty, total applicants, and seat availability.

BITSAT Cutoff 2023-2025 Trends

Let's have a close look at the cutoff table below. You will observe that the cutoff shows a declining trend. Have you wondered what can be the possible reason for such a trend, as normally the cutoff is supposed to follow an upward trend. Let us break this down. There have been some changes in the exam format, test slots and the marking scheme, which might have led to this decline in the cutoff. Here is how the Pilani cutoffs moved for the most sought-after branches:

Programme

2023

2024

2025

B.E. Computer Science

331

327

304

B.E. Electronics & Communication

296

314

285

B.E. Electrical & Electronics

272

292

260

B.E. Mathematics & Computing

318

295

B.E. Electronics & Instrumentation

266

282

250

B.E. Mechanical

244

266

235

B.E. Chemical

224

247

210

B.E. Civil

213

238

206

Key Observations from the BITSAT Cutoff Trend

CSE in any of the BITS campuses i.e. Pilani, Goa or Hyderabad is not easy to crack and you are aware of that. If we observe the numbers closely, the B.Tech CSE cutoff in Pilani has fallen 27 points in only two years. Suppose your senior had achieved a score of 331 to qualify the exam, you might just need a 304 to qualify the same. You both were aiming at the same target but the threshold is different. How to Use These BITSAT 2026 Cutoffs

We have provided this cutoff trend so that you may be better prepared for your upcoming point of action. However please do remember that these predicted cutoff marks are not set in stone and the actual result may be something different. I will suggest you aim for a score which is 10-15 points above these cutoff score so as to be on a safer side. If you wish to attain a seat in CSE BITS Pilani then aim for a score of 310 or more. For a seat in the B.Tech ECE or EEE course, you must focus on achieving a score of 270 to 285.
